> Kevin,
>
>
>
> Your registry setting for the latency of products could potentially be
> blamed here as well. Check `regutil` for `/server/max-latency` since
> depending on that value, your LDM will not retrieve products older than
> that age.
>
>
>
> This is just a shot in the dark since I don't know what the product
> generation vs.delivery latency was.
